Jacqueline (Jackie) Thomsen – Co-Founder and Director

Jackie worked for the Boeing Company, City of Seattle’s Building and Engineering Departments and Seattle’s Department of Parks and Recreation and Nordstrom.  She and her late husband, Dave, owned and operated Dave Magera Electric Co. for twenty-one years, specializing in commercial construction, and installation of POS systems for Texaco and Shell Oil Companies.  She described herself as the gofer, secretary, accountant and parttime helper on the job and became pretty darn good at running wire, while raising six children!  How can anyone top that?  She is our true multi-threat Board Member.

 

She met Chris Thomsen in 2001 while working for KONE Elevator Company where Chris worked.  They married in 2003 and are proud to be a “Made in America” business.  They enjoy spending time on their boat fishing, crabbing and being on the waters of Puget Sound. In addition to Chris, Thomsen’s, Inc., the Queen Anne Lutheran Church and her Sewing and Service Group, she loves reading, movies, television series and their two cats.  We have no idea where she finds the time.
